Студопедия

КАТЕГОРИИ:

АвтомобилиАстрономияБиологияГеографияДом и садД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еталлургияМ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РелигияРиторикаСоциологияСпортСтроительствоТехнологияТуризмФ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ника



Этапы подготовки и решения задач на ЭВМ. 10) Конспект лекцій з системного програмування.




Читайте также:
  1. Gt; во-вторых, когнитивной оценкой (cognitive appraisal), которую человек дает событию, требующему разрешения.
  2. Hешаем задачу
  3. I. Задачи настоящей работы
  4. I. Решение логических задач средствами алгебры логики
  5. I. Цели и задачи проекта
  6. II. Объем и сроки выполнения задач в рамках проекта
  7. II. Основные цели и задачи Программы, срок и этапы ее реализации, целевые индикаторы и показатели
  8. II. Основные этапы развития физики Становление физики (до 17 в.).
  9. II. Решение логических задач табличным способом
  10. II. Упражнения и задачи

9) Рудаков П.И., Фіногенов К.Г. Програмуєм на мові ассемблер IBM PC, 1992. – 260с.

10) Конспект лекцій з системного програмування.

 

 

Учебное пособие

По курсу «Информатика»

для студентов специальностей 2701-2709

Утверждено методической комиссией

2003 года

Москва 2004

Оглавление

Введение

Этапы подготовки и решения задач на ЭВМ

АЛГОРИТМИЗАЦИЯ ВЫЧИСЛИТЕЛЬНЫХ ПРОЦЕССОВ

Графический метод описания алгоритмов

Виды вычислительных процессов

2.2.1. Вычислительный процесс линейной структуры

Вычислительный процесс разветвляющейся структуры

2.2.3.Вычислительный процесс циклической структуры.

Языки программирования.

Основные понятия языка QBASIC

Алфавит

Структура данных

Операторы языка

Операторы ввода-вывода

Примеры работы с символьными переменными.

Работа с файлами

Требования к имени файла

Операции над файлами

Открытие файла

Запись в файл

Чтение из файла

Изменения данных в файле

Добавление данных в файл

Оператор графики

МЕТОДИЧЕСКИЕ УКАЗАНИЯ

10. Тестовые задания по теме: Основы алгоритмизации и языки программирования.

Краткий справочник по языку QBASIC.

Сообщения об ошибках и их коды

Список литературы.

 

Введение

 

В учебном пособии рассмотрены основные этапы подготовки и решения задач на ЭВМ. Рассмотрены основные виды вычислительных процессов: линейный, разветвляющийся, циклический. Даётся подробное изложение решения примеров различной сложности. Приводятся задачи табулирования функции с вычислением максимума, минимума, задачи на сложные циклы, циклы с разветвлением, включающие вычисление суммы и произведения.



В пособии даётся подробное описание языка QBASIC: структура программы, основные символы, конструкция языка.

Методические указания, приведённые в пособии, будут полезными для студентов заочной формы обучения при выполнении контрольных заданий.

Приводится большое количество примеров для самостоятельного решения.

Подробность и доступность изложения делает это пособие удобным для самостоятельного решения задач разной сложности.

 

 

Этапы подготовки и решения задач на ЭВМ

 

Основные этапы подготовки и решения задач на ЭВМ представлены на рисунке 1.

Рассмотрим эти этапы.

ЭТАП 1. Содержательная постановка задачи.

Специалистом той области знаний, для которой решается задача, дается содержательное описание процесса или объекта, который необходимо исследовать. Дается точная формулировка цели решения задачи, т.е. определяется, что именно нужно решить и в каком виде желательно получить результаты. Разрабатывается структура исходных данных.

ЭТАП 2.Математическая постановка задачи.

На этом этапе задача формулируется на математическом языке в виде абстрактных математических формул и соотношений. При этом устанавливаются математические зависимости между исходными данными и результатами вычислений. На данном этапе желательно ввести обозначения / имена / всех переменных, используемых при решении, и привести их в соответствие с возможностью обозначения переменных на соответствующем алгоритмическом языке. При этом удобно пользоваться табл. 1.




Дата добавления: 2015-01-01; просмотров: 19; Нарушение авторских прав







lektsii.com - Лекции.Ком - 2014-2021 год. (0.011 сек.)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ав
Главная страница Случайная страница Контакты